The Bunker Complex Ungerberg is a Cold War-era military fortification located in Austria. Built as part of Austria's secret defense network during the Cold War period (1963-2002), this bunker was designed to protect the neutral Alpine republic from potential NATO or Warsaw Pact incursions. The complex features a massive concrete structure with walls two and a half meters thick, demonstrating the extensive efforts made to withstand attacks for extended periods.

The interior of the bunker contains specialized facilities including a telephone exchange for communications, a medical room for treating wounded personnel, and even a niche for coffins, indicating its design for long-term autonomous operation. A decommissioned howitzer remains on site in working condition due to careful maintenance. The complex is now part of Austria's military heritage and represents the country's extensive fortification efforts during the Cold War era.
